“Many dogs suffer from food allergies,” explains Dr. Rachel Barrack, DVM, certified veterinary acupuncturist and certified Chinese Herbalist at Animal Acupuncture in New York City. “Common signs include red, itchy paws; chronically inflamed or infection-prone ears; and severe skin disease.” Other symptoms of food sensitivities often include persistent skin irritation, recurring ear and skin infections, and gastrointestinal issues like vomiting and diarrhea. Left unaddressed, these sensitivities can also contribute to chronic pain and unhealthy weight gain.

Beyond allergies, an increasing number of dogs are overweight—and developing serious age-related conditions such as cancer, heart disease, and diabetes. “These conditions can significantly impact a pet’s health and daily quality of life,” says Dr. Barrack. The Organic Difference

The Association of American Feed Control Officials (AAFCO) doesn’t define “organic” specifically for pet food. Instead, organic pet products follow the U.S. Department of Agriculture (USDA) standards used for human food. To earn USDA organic certification:

  • Plant-based ingredients must be grown without synthetic pesticides, artificial fertilizers, genetic modification, irradiation, or sewage sludge.
  • Animal-derived ingredients must come from animals raised on certified organic feed, given outdoor access, and never treated with antibiotics or growth hormones.
  • Farmers and manufacturers must undergo rigorous third-party certification and adhere to strict production protocols.

Labels reflect varying degrees of organic content:

  • 100% Organic: Contains only certified organic ingredients (excluding water and salt).
  • Organic: At least 95% of ingredients are certified organic.
  • Made with Organic Ingredients: Contains at least 70% certified organic ingredients.

True organic dog treats are free from artificial sweeteners, synthetic colors, and chemical preservatives like BHA, BHT, or ethoxyquin. In contrast, conventional treats may include genetically modified corn or soy, rendered animal meals (not fit for human consumption), meat by-products, artificial dyes, and additives such as monosodium glutamate (MSG).
